Alexei Popyrin advances to last 16 of French Open after beating Nuno Borges

Friday 30th May 2025, 6:33PM

Sydneysider wins tough contest 6-4 7-6 (13-11) 7-6 (7-5)No 25 seed is the last Australian man left at Roland GarrosAlexei Popyrin has ensured there was no hangover from Alex de Minaur’s early exit as he got hot on a baking Paris day to reach the last-16 of the French Open with a touch of swagger and a sprinkling of good old-fashioned Aussie grit.The country’s No 2 player isn’t now just the last man standing in the draw but the last man positively thriving as he downed quality Portuguese Nuno Borges 6-4 7-6 (13-11) 7-6 (7-5) in the Court 14 furnace at Roland Garros to reach the last-16 on Friday.Alexei Popyrin is through to the last 16 for the first time in Paris!#RolandGarros pic.twitter.com/JgfPLfu2aO— Roland-Garros (@rolandgarros) May 30, 2025 Continue reading...
